Tackling MS01: Your Path to OSCP Certification
The Offensive Security Certified Professional (OSCP) certification is the ultimate respected credential in the cybersecurity industry. To achieve this prestigious title, you must first conquer MS01, the challenging hands-on exam that tests your penetration testing skills. This article will guide you through the process of preparing for MS01 and set you on the path to OSCP certification.
MS01 throws complex security scenarios at you, requiring you to identify vulnerabilities. You'll need to showcase expertise in a wide range of techniques, including reconnaissance, exploitation, and post-exploitation. To achieve this exam, you'll need to go beyond simply memorizing concepts. You must truly understand the underlying principles of penetration testing and be able to apply them in real-world situations.
- {Embrace hands-on learning: The best way to prepare for MS01 is to actively practice your skills. Engage in Capture the Flag (CTF) competitions, solve labs, and build your own penetration testing environment.
- {Focus on fundamentals: Build a strong foundation in networking, operating systems, and common vulnerabilities. Understand how different security controls work and how attackers can bypass them.
- {Master the tools of the trade: Familiarize yourself with popular penetration testing tools such as Nmap, Metasploit, Burp Suite, and Wireshark. Learn their functionalities and how to use them effectively.
- {Practice time management: The MS01 exam is time-constrained. Develop strategies for efficiently addressing scenarios. Practice under timed conditions to improve your speed and accuracy.
By following these tips, you can effectively prepare for the challenges of MS01 and increase your chances of achieving OSCP certification. Remember, success in penetration testing requires commitment, continuous learning, and a passion for cybersecurity.
The Value of an OSCP Certificate in Today's Market
In today's rapidly evolving cybersecurity landscape, obtaining a recognized and respected qualification is paramount for professionals seeking to progress their careers. The Offensive Security Certified Professional (OSCP) certificate stands as a testament to an individual's hands-on skills in penetration testing, earning it high regard within the industry. Employers actively seek candidates possessing this desirable credential, recognizing its demonstration of real-world expertise.
The OSCP's rigorous training, which emphasizes practical simulations, equips individuals with the skill to identify and exploit vulnerabilities within complex systems. This hands-on approach sets it apart from other credentials, making OSCP holders highly attractive assets to organizations guarding against read more cyber threats.
